Watford's Health Campus and Riverwell regeneration projects have brought sustained new-build investment to the town. The mix here is heavier on apartments and townhouses than the surrounding Hertfordshire suburbs, reflecting Watford's London-fringe context.

Watford Junction sits on the West Coast Main Line — London Euston in around 20 minutes — and Watford station gives access to the Metropolitan Line. The M25 (J19/20) and M1 (J5) are within 10 minutes. That access combined with central London proximity drives apartment-led development heavier than anywhere else in Hertfordshire bar London proper. Berkeley have led the Riverwell regeneration; Crest Nicholson and Galliard have followed in around the central area.

Why a snagging survey matters in Watford

Apartment-led in the central regeneration zones (Riverwell, Health Campus), townhouse and mews mix in the connecting areas, with smaller volumes of detached homes on the western and northern edges.

On Watford apartments, balcony glazing, MVHR commissioning and communal-area handover are recurring themes. Town-centre regeneration plots also flag external façade-quality concerns more often than the Hertfordshire suburbs — though those typically sit outside leaseholder demise. On the suburban edges, brickwork mortar consistency and external paving alignment are the regular flags.

The official numbers are sobering. The HBF's 2025 New Homes Review found that 93.7% of new-build buyers reported snags after moving in, with 26.2% reporting more than 15 defects. Industry data shows professional inspectors typically identify 150+ defects on a new home, while unaided buyers usually find 20–30. The gap is the things you can't reach — the roof, the loft insulation, behind appliances, inside service voids — and the things you wouldn't know to look for without years of experience.

The numbers, plainly:
  • 93.7% of new-build buyers reported snags (HBF 2025)
  • 26.2% reported more than 15 defects
  • Inspectors typically find 150+ items; buyers find 20–30

Pre-completion or post-completion — which to choose

A Pre-Completion Inspection (PCI) is conducted 1–2 weeks before legal completion using the NHQB checklist. For Watford's mixed-use schemes this can be slightly more complex — apartment blocks need to be ready for handover before snagging meaningfully starts, and houses can usually be PCI'd earlier. We'll advise on timing when you book.

A post-completion inspection takes place after legal completion. Once you own the property, the developer is required to fix reported defects within 30 days, and you're covered for up to two years under your warranty. For apartments, this is usually the practical option — the building's communal handover has typically settled by then.

Both options are valid. PCI is more useful for houses; post-completion is often the practical choice for apartments. The price is the same regardless.

A recent Watford inspection

A 2-bed Berkeley apartment at Watford Riverwell last winter produced 96 items. Standouts: balcony glazing seal failure at a corner detail (already showing condensation), MVHR unit not balanced, hot-water pressure dropping below spec at peak, and a kitchen tap that hadn't been properly secured to the worktop.

Pre-completion or post-completion — which should I book?

Pre-completion (PCI) is conducted 1–2 weeks before legal completion using the NHQB checklist; the developer can fix issues before you exchange. Post-completion happens once you own the property; the developer is then required to fix reported defects within 30 days. PCI gives you leverage; post-completion gives you a paper trail. Both work, both are priced the same.

Is the inspection different for an apartment vs a house in Watford?

Yes. For an apartment we focus on what's within your demise — your unit, your balcony, the connection points to communal services. For a house it's the full envelope (roof, brickwork, render, garden). Both get the same depth of coverage, just different priorities. Pricing is the same.

Is Watford's apartment-heavy mix a problem for first-time buyers?

It depends on what you want. Apartments here come with service charges and management overheads that don't apply to suburban houses, but they also offer London-fringe access at substantially lower prices than the city itself. We can flag specific block-level concerns during the inspection.
